Skip to content

Commit 5f90fe4

Browse files
committed
chore: rebuilt with latest spec 1.0.3
1 parent 63e7ce3 commit 5f90fe4

File tree

2 files changed

+14
-7
lines changed

2 files changed

+14
-7
lines changed

docs/Model/Thing.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44

55
Name | Type | Description | Notes
66
------------ | ------------- | ------------- | -------------
7-
**kind** | **string** | | [optional]
8-
**data** | [**\Sigwin\RedditClient\Model\ThingData**](ThingData.md) | | [optional]
7+
**kind** | **string** | |
8+
**data** | [**\Sigwin\RedditClient\Model\ThingData**](ThingData.md) | |
99

1010
[[Back to Model list]](../../README.md#models) [[Back to API list]](../../README.md#endpoints) [[Back to README]](../../README.md)

src/Model/Thing.php

Lines changed: 12 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-187,6 +187,9 @@ public function listInvalidProperties(): array
187187
{
188188
$invalidProperties = [];
189189

190+
if ($this->container['kind'] === null) {
191+
$invalidProperties[] = "'kind' can't be null";
192+
}
190193
$allowedValues = $this->getKindAllowableValues();
191194
if (null !== $this->container['kind'] && ! \in_array($this->container['kind'], $allowedValues, true)) {
192195
$invalidProperties[] = sprintf(
@@ -196,6 +199,10 @@ public function listInvalidProperties(): array
196199
);
197200
}
198201

202+
if ($this->container['data'] === null) {
203+
$invalidProperties[] = "'data' can't be null";
204+
}
205+
199206
return $invalidProperties;
200207
}
201208

@@ -213,20 +220,20 @@ public function valid(): bool
213220
/**
214221
* Gets kind.
215222
*/
216-
public function getKind(): ?string
223+
public function getKind(): string
217224
{
218225
return $this->container['kind'];
219226
}
220227

221228
/**
222229
* Sets kind.
223230
*
224-
* @param null|string $kind kind
231+
* @param string $kind kind
225232
*/
226233
public function setKind($kind): self
227234
{
228235
$allowedValues = $this->getKindAllowableValues();
229-
if (null !== $kind && ! \in_array($kind, $allowedValues, true)) {
236+
if ( ! \in_array($kind, $allowedValues, true)) {
230237
throw new \InvalidArgumentException(sprintf("Invalid value '%s' for 'kind', must be one of '%s'", $kind, implode("', '", $allowedValues)));
231238
}
232239
$this->container['kind'] = $kind;
@@ -237,15 +244,15 @@ public function setKind($kind): self
237244
/**
238245
* Gets data.
239246
*/
240-
public function getData(): ?\Sigwin\RedditClient\Model\ThingData
247+
public function getData(): \Sigwin\RedditClient\Model\ThingData
241248
{
242249
return $this->container['data'];
243250
}
244251

245252
/**
246253
* Sets data.
247254
*
248-
* @param null|\Sigwin\RedditClient\Model\ThingData $data data
255+
* @param \Sigwin\RedditClient\Model\ThingData $data data
249256
*/
250257
public function setData($data): self
251258
{

0 commit comments

Comments
 (0)